Biografia

Cortney Richardson is an incredible voice with a powerful sound that will lift your heart and stir the soul. A native of Memphis, Tennessee, Cortney brings a new sound with an infectious voice that everyone loves. With passion, talent and a powerful message of faith, hope, unity and love, Cortney continues to impact young and old alike through his gifts of music, training and teaching.

Raised by his parents who orchestrated their own choirs Cortney gave his debut solo performance as young boy at the age of four years old. Later, this musical prodigy evolved as a premiere songwriter, producer and minister of the gospel with a rich heritage of influencers from Memphis’ enduring music culture ranging from B.B. King, the Staple Singers, and Otis Redding to Orlando Draper and the Associates.


In 2013 Cortney released his freshman project In This Place which reached the Top 20 chart on iTunes. He continues to be heard around the globe as he tours annually. Cortney has received many accolades for his work both musically and civically. Most recently, he received the Memphis Music Ambassador Award. Additionally, his revolutionary leadership while at alma mater the University of Memphis distinguished has him as an advocate of social justice and a visionary leader in ministry.

2018 marks the sophomore release of Cortney’s latest musical masterpiece, “Do it Again.” This work features powerful lyrics, masterful musicianship and impeccable vocal quality that captures the essence of great gospel sound. It’s undeniable Cortney currently serves as Youth and Young Adult Pastor at New Life of Memphis and Program Director/Ambassador for the Peer Power Foundation, a youth development organization which hires high performing college and high school students to tutor their peers. Cortney strongly believes in the power of the word of God. His life’s passion is to know Jesus and to make Him known!
